Fashioned by Sargent -- inside the exhibition and the catalog (4.14.24)

Oh how I wish this exhibition would tour more! This show matches famous Sargent works with the actual fashions depicted. What a resource for scholars/fans of art and textiles!  The show debuted in Boston and is at the Tate in London now. The Exhibition catalog is at the SNB store and on the website.
